Output ab12821149dfc6548031e12e0c34bb84b85aee299e608cc44725dfabe10eea61:4

value
24339700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73833c226e965f24716dec678451f28f596a74a OP_EQUAL
address
MUyjejpM6dy3qkkK5WHQNH6iaGXXLhZh1N
transaction
ab12821149dfc6548031e12e0c34bb84b85aee299e608cc44725dfabe10eea61
spent
true